(vast-ly) 2 syllables

Definition

adverb. to a very great extent or degree.

Example Sentence

They were vastly better at playing cards than expected.

More Example Sentences

Her skills improved vastly over the summer.

Synonyms

greatly; significantly; enormously

Antonyms

little
